Selecting the Proper Squash
To make sure a profitable storage expertise in your spaghetti squash, cautious choice is paramount. Listed here are some key standards to think about when selecting the proper squash:
1. Examine the Exterior:
- Dimension and Form: Go for medium to large-sized squash with a symmetrical, elongated form. Keep away from specimens with bruises, cuts, or comfortable spots.
- Shade: Hunt down squash with a deep yellow or orange-yellow hue. Uninteresting or pale-colored squash could point out overripeness or poor high quality.
- Weight: Select squash that feels heavy for its dimension. A heavy squash sometimes signifies a dense and meaty inside.
2. Examine the Stem:
- The stem must be dry and barely woody, indicating the squash has totally matured and is prepared for storage.
- Keep away from squash with a inexperienced or fresh-looking stem, as this will likely signify immaturity and decrease shelf life.

Storing Complete Squash
Retailer complete, uncured spaghetti squash in a cool, darkish, and well-ventilated space with a temperature between 50-55°F (10-13°C). Preserve a relative humidity of 60-70% to stop the squash from shriveling. Beneath these circumstances, complete squash will be saved for as much as 6 months.
Storage Methodology | Length |
---|---|
Cool, darkish, and well-ventilated space (50-55°F, 60-70% humidity) | As much as 6 months |
Ultimate Storage Circumstances
Complete Spaghetti Squash
To retailer complete spaghetti squash, maintain it in a cool, dry place with good air flow. Keep away from storing it in direct daylight or in areas with excessive humidity, as these circumstances can promote spoilage. Ultimate storage temperatures vary from 50 to 60°F (10 to 16°C).
Minimize Spaghetti Squash
Minimize spaghetti squash must be refrigerated to stop spoilage. Retailer the squash in an hermetic container and eat it inside 3 to 4 days. For longer storage, you’ll be able to freeze the squash for as much as 3 months.
Cooked Spaghetti Squash
Cooked spaghetti squash will be saved within the fridge for 3 to 4 days in an hermetic container. You can too freeze cooked squash for as much as 2 months. To reheat, thaw the squash within the fridge in a single day or microwave it for a couple of minutes till warmed via.

Freezing Issues
Freezing spaghetti squash is an effective way to protect its freshness and lengthen its shelf life. Observe these steps for optimum freezing outcomes:
1. Put together the Squash
Wash the spaghetti squash totally and lower it in half lengthwise. Take away the seeds and stringy pulp from the middle.
2. Bake or Roast
Place the squash halves cut-side down on a baking sheet and bake at 400°F (200°C) for about 45 minutes, or till the flesh is tender and simply pierced with a fork.
3. Shred the Flesh
As soon as the squash has cooled barely, use a fork to shred the flesh into spaghetti-like strands. Discard the pores and skin.
4. Portion and Freeze
Divide the shredded squash into parts and place it in freezer-safe containers. Label and date the containers for straightforward identification. The squash will be frozen for as much as 6 months.
